pg电子迎财神改代码,全面解析与实现方案pg电子迎财神改代码

pg电子迎财神改代码,全面解析与实现方案pg电子迎财神改代码,

本文目录导读:

  1. 功能需求分析
  2. 技术实现方案
  3. 测试与优化
  4. 注意事项

在游戏开发中,活动是提升玩家粘性和活跃度的重要手段之一,而“迎财神”作为一种传统文化与游戏元素相结合的活动,不仅能够增强玩家的游戏体验,还能通过奖励机制提升游戏的商业价值,本文将从功能需求、技术实现、测试与优化等方面,全面解析如何通过代码实现“pg电子迎财神”活动,并提供一个完整的解决方案。


功能需求分析

“迎财神”活动的核心目标是通过代码实现以下功能:

  1. 活动时间设置:活动时间通常集中在春节前后,需要通过代码精确控制活动的开始时间和结束时间。
  2. 奖励发放机制:在活动时间内,玩家参与相关游戏行为(如登录、消费、完成特定任务等)后,系统会自动发放奖励,奖励可以是游戏内的虚拟货币(如pg电子)或游戏道具。
  3. 玩家数据统计:统计活动期间玩家的参与次数、累计奖励金额等数据,便于后续分析和优化。
  4. 活动展示界面:在活动期间,游戏内需要展示迎财神的活动页面,吸引玩家参与。
  5. 活动效果分析:通过数据分析,评估活动对玩家行为的影响,为后续活动设计提供参考。

技术实现方案

为了实现上述功能,我们需要从以下几个方面进行技术设计和实现:

数据库设计

为了记录玩家的活动数据,我们需要设计一个数据库表来存储相关信息,以下是数据库设计的主要字段:

  • player_id:玩家的唯一标识,用于区分不同玩家。
  • account_id:玩家的账号ID,便于关联玩家信息。
  • active_time:玩家的活动时间戳,记录玩家参与活动的时间。
  • reward_amount:玩家获得的奖励金额,单位为pg电子货币。
  • last_activity_time:玩家上一次活动的时间戳,用于判断玩家是否连续参与活动。

活动时间设置

活动时间可以通过服务器端配置实现,具体步骤如下:

  1. 在服务器上设置活动开始时间和结束时间,例如2024年2月1日00:00:00至2024年2月15日23:59:59。
  2. 使用数据库触发器或脚本,在活动开始时触发奖励发放逻辑。
  3. 在活动结束时,系统会自动终止奖励发放机制。

奖励发放逻辑

奖励发放逻辑需要通过代码实现,主要分为以下几个步骤:

  1. 玩家登录检查:在活动期间,检查玩家是否登录游戏,如果玩家登录,则触发活动相关奖励。
  2. 活动参与判断:根据玩家的游戏行为(如登录、消费、完成任务等)判断其是否符合参与活动的条件。
  3. 奖励计算与发放:根据玩家的活动次数或累计消费金额,计算应获得的奖励金额,并通过游戏内货币系统将其发放给玩家。
  4. 数据同步:将玩家的活动数据同步到数据库中,便于后续分析。

活动展示界面

为了提升玩家的参与感,活动期间需要在游戏内展示迎财神的活动页面,以下是实现步骤:

  1. 在游戏的客户端中,创建一个独立的活动面板,展示活动的时间、奖励内容和参与方式。
  2. 使用UI框架(如Unity或WebGL)设计活动页面的视觉效果,确保界面简洁明了,吸引玩家点击参与。
  3. 在活动开始时,触发活动页面的展示逻辑,确保玩家能够及时看到活动信息。

活动效果分析

为了评估活动的效果,需要通过数据分析工具对玩家的活动数据进行统计和分析,以下是分析的主要指标:

  • 玩家参与率:活动期间玩家的参与次数与总玩家数的比例。
  • 累计奖励金额:所有参与活动的玩家获得的总奖励金额。
  • 活跃度:活动期间玩家的每日活跃次数和时长。

测试与优化

为了确保活动的顺利进行,需要对代码进行多次测试和优化:

单元测试

在代码实现每个功能模块后,进行单元测试,确保每个模块都能正常运行。

  • 测试活动时间设置是否正确。
  • 测试奖励发放逻辑是否能正确触发。
  • 测试活动展示界面是否能够正确显示。

系统测试

在所有模块测试通过后,进行系统测试,确保活动的整体运行流畅。

  • 测试多个玩家同时参与活动时的奖励发放逻辑。
  • 测试网络延迟对活动的影响。
  • 测试玩家数据的同步与更新。

性能优化

在测试通过后,对代码进行性能优化,确保活动在高并发情况下仍能正常运行。

  • 优化数据库查询性能。
  • 使用缓存机制减少数据库的负载。
  • 优化活动逻辑,减少不必要的操作。

注意事项

在实现“迎财神”活动的过程中,需要注意以下几点:

  1. 代码安全:确保活动代码的安全性,防止被恶意攻击或数据泄露。
  2. 玩家数据隐私:在处理玩家数据时,必须遵守相关法律法规,确保玩家数据的隐私性。
  3. 活动公平性:确保活动的奖励发放逻辑公平,避免玩家通过作弊手段获取不合理的奖励。
  4. 代码维护性:设计代码时要遵循“模块化”原则,便于以后的功能扩展和维护。

“迎财神”活动是游戏开发中一个非常重要的功能模块,通过代码实现,能够提升玩家的参与感和游戏的商业价值,本文从功能需求、技术实现、测试与优化等方面,全面解析了如何通过代码实现“pg电子迎财神”活动,并提供了一个完整的解决方案,希望本文能够为游戏开发者提供一些参考和灵感,帮助他们更好地设计和实现类似的功能模块。

pg电子迎财神改代码,全面解析与实现方案pg电子迎财神改代码,

发表评论